Capítulo 6: Creación de un formulario con Macros VBA

🔴 En este capítulo, aplicaremos lo aprendido para la creación de un formulario de registro haciendo uso de Macros y un poco de programación VBA. No te preocupes, que el código lo revisaremos paso a paso y podrás copiarlo de aquí para implementarlo tú mismo. ¡Empecemos!


Código VBA del Formulario

print: "cap6-VBA-code";

Este curso es gratis y siempre lo será. Apóyanos compartiéndolo con tus amigos.

Miguel Vela

Related Articles

Responses

Tu dirección de correo electrónico no será publicada. Los campos obligatorios están marcados con *

  1. Buenas tarde Tio Tech

    Otra Consulta:
    En los formularios, en el botón (Cuadro combinado), se puede llamar o relacionar una lista que se tenga en una hoja de Excel sin necesidad de digitar las opciones directamente en la macro?

    Ejemplo:
    Si el botón es «Tipo de contrato», que yo no tenga que digitar en la macro (Indefinido, Fijo, Prestación de servicio, Por obra, Aprendiz, etc.) sino que yo llame el listado que ya tenga en Excel con la misma información.

    De antemano agradezco por tu respuesta y valiosos aportes

    Quedo muy pendiente

  2. Buena noche si yo quisiera colocarle un botón al formulario que diga salir como seria su PROGRAMACIÓN en VBA

  3. Genial Tio Tech, una pregunta, como haria para que el texto que escriba en los box esten siempre en mayuscula?
    agradezco de antemano tu respuesta.

  4. Buenas noches, consulta.

    Tengo una lista de alumnos que la tengo en una hoja 1 y lo que quiero es confeccionar una ficha para pada uno. Esta ficha debe incluir el logo de mi cuna, la foto del niño y la información general….nombre, DNI, Nombre de los padres, teléfonos y mas…son 16 items.

    Debo ser capaz de: Seleccionar con criterio de búsqueda a cada uno en la página 1, transportar esa información a la hoja o página 2 (la información está en distintos casilleros). Una vez con su foto y el logo….imprimirlo…!. LA HOJA DEBE QUEDAR LISTA PARA REALIZAR LA ACCIÓN PARA EL SIGUIENTE O NUEVO ALUMNO.

    En cuál de las lecciones puedo encontrar esa opción…??.

    Agradezco tu ayuda.

    Jorge Puerta

  5. Gracias, Miguel. Una PREGUNTA: si quisiera que una vez insertado el nuevo registro, me ordene la tabla alfabéticamente, por nombre, por ejemplo, ¿podría añadir al final de la parte del código de limpiar otro segmento de un código de ordenar la tabla? Gracias

  6. Tengo un problema: no me corre la macro desde el boton agregar. He llegado hasta este punto pero no puedo seguir.

  7. Buenas Tardes Tio Tech!, Soy Profesor De Informatica En El Colegio De Mis Alumnos, Muchas Gracias Por Tus Cursos, Me Ayudaron A Dar Clases En El Colegio De Mis Alumnos.
    Cordiales Saludos.
    -Oscal

  8. Hola, gracias a tus videos eh mejorado mi rendimiento en el trabajo..
    tengo una pregunta y espero puedas ayudarme , como puedo hacer para que una vez registrada la información en la tabla y luego de guardarla, la información no pueda ser alterada por otra persona que ingrese a registrar otros datos en el misma tabla, eso quiere decir que cada vez que se ingrese una nueva fila, se ingresen los datos y se guarde, esta fila quede bloqueada automáticamente . saludos.

  9. Excelente, Miguel me encantaron los cursos. Por favor me interesarían cursos más avanzados como VBA por favor, están excelentes las clases.

  10. cuando agregas a la tabla siempre lo agregabas al principio de la tabla, pero si lo deseas agregar alfinal de la tabla como se podria hacer?

  11. buens tardes» me parece muy interesante, las clases, sobre todo los formularios, ya lo hice, pero no lo agrega, dice que no estoy autorizado, será, porque mi Excel, no es comprado?